11 January 2019
Temporary closure of Saadani airstrip
By *Gabriele Manzoni, Coastal AviationDear Partners
We would like to inform you that Saadani airstrip in Tanzania has been closed by the Tanzania Civil Aviation Authority from 6th January till 6th February 2019 due to the maintenance of the airfield.
The destination has been already restricted from sale during the above dates and existing bookings are being contacted by our Reservations department to arrange a different itinerary. For existing and future bookings, we are able to offer flights into Kwajoni, the closest airstrip.
